Leviticus 3:17
This shall be a perpetual statute throughout your generations in all your dwellings: you shall eat neither fat nor blood.
Leviticus 7:26
Moreover you shall not eat any blood in any of your dwellings, whether of bird or beast.
Leviticus 17:10-14
10
And any man of the house of Israel, or of the strangers who sojourn among you, who eats any blood, I will set My face against that soul who eats blood, and will cut him off from among his people.
11
For the soul of the flesh is in the blood, and I have given it to you upon the altar to make atonement for your souls; for it is the blood that makes atonement for the soul.
12
Therefore I have said to the children of Israel, No one among you shall eat blood, nor shall any stranger who sojourns among you eat blood.
13
Any man of the sons of Israel, or of the strangers who sojourn among you, who hunts and catches any animal or flying creature that may be eaten, he shall pour out its blood and cover it with dust;
14
for it is the soul of all flesh. Its blood is its soul. Therefore I said to the children of Israel, You shall not eat the blood of any flesh, for the soul of all flesh is its blood. Whoever eats it shall be cut off.
Leviticus 19:26
You shall not eat anything with the blood, nor shall you practice divination nor fortunetelling.
Deuteronomy 12:16
Only you shall not eat the blood; you shall pour it on the earth like water.
Deuteronomy 12:23
Only be sure not to eat the blood, for the blood is the soul; you shall not eat the soul with the flesh.
